WebInverse Distance Weighting (IDW) In the inverse distance weighting (IDW) approach, also referred to as inverse distance-based weighted interpolation, the estimation of the value z at location x is a weighted mean of nearby observations. wi = x − xi −β and where β ≥ 0 and ⋅ corresponds to the euclidean distance. Web24 feb. 2012 · Inverse distance weighting (IDW) multivariate interpolation. The code performs an Inverse distance weighting (IDW) multivariate interpolation, i.e. a process of assigning values to unknown points by using values from usually scattered set of known points.
